Executive team and branch managers,

After a thorough review of occupancy costs and staffing patterns, we have decided to close the Nerrowgate satellite office at the end of next quarter. All seven staff will be offered transfers to the Caldmere branch, with relocation support where needed. Lease termination terms have been negotiated favorably, and client coverage will continue uninterrupted through remote arrangements. Please handle communications with discretion. The underlying reasoning is set out directly below.

confidential, bahap-bajog: Zorethix Works is in early talks to buy Kelethox Foods for about $30.7 million. The Ralvan launch date is September 19, and nothing goes to the press before then.

## Authentication

Quick note for new folks: the Pondworth health-check endpoints (`/healthz`, `/readyz`) sit behind the Gatewing load balancer, and Gatewing won't forward unauthenticated probes in staging. Production probes come from the balancer itself and are allowlisted, so you only hit this locally or in staging. When testing by hand, pass the service credential as a bearer header or everything returns 403 and looks like an outage. The staging credential to use is below.

API key for yahig-tadup: kto7_ubizbYm

Subject: Overnight cage visit — Halden Row data centre. Night team: two engineers from our Meridex Platforms group are scheduled to service cage 14 between 01:00 and 03:00 tonight. Please check their names against the visit roster at the front desk, have them sign the cage log, and confirm they carry no storage media on exit. Escort them through the mantrap both ways. To release the inner corridor door for escorted entry, use the code below.

door code, yagap-bahof: bdg-O-05

### Checklist item 12 — Spreadsheet export memory ceiling

Before sign-off, run the Ledgerfield export suite against the 500k-row fixture workbook and confirm peak resident memory stays under the 1.5 GB ceiling. New team members: the exporter streams rows by default, but a regression in chunk buffering can silently switch it to full in-memory mode, so watch the memory graph, not just the pass/fail result. Record the peak value in the release sheet, then verify the candidate build matches the trace token shown below.

pipeline stamp: htk31_f769b577b3028a4e9958e5bb8d1259a